Cost of Living Calculator - Free Union, Virginia vs Charlotte, North Carolina


The cost of living in Charlotte, North Carolina is 16.4% cheaper than Free Union, Virginia.

You would need a salary of $62,732 in Charlotte, North Carolina to maintain the standard of living you have in Free Union, Virginia.
